Built for Building Information Modeling (BIM), Autodesk Revit software, in the Building Design Suite Premium and Ultimate editions, combines features for architectural design, MEP and structural engineering, and construction, in a single, comprehensive application.
The Building Design Suite includes software that enables users to incorporate include real-world data in designs. There are three levels of the Building Design Suite, and all have had improvements.

Autodesk® ReCap™
Software to help capture and integrate 3D reality data from laser scans and photos directly into your design process. For 2016, ReCap enhancements include:
- Support for new native laser scan formats
- Smart measurement tools to help measure diameters and distances with automatic shape fitting
- Ability to add tags, notes, pictures and hyperlinks to ReCap files and have them automatically sync between a desktop and the cloud
Autodesk® AutoCAD® Raster Design
Raster to vector conversion software helps you easily edit, enhance, and maintain scanned drawings and plans in a familiar Autodesk® AutoCAD® environment. Make the most of raster images, maps, aerial photos, satellite imagery, and digital elevation models by including them in designs.
Autodesk® Showcase®
Easily transform AutoCAD designs and Revit models into compelling imagery, movies, and presentation for interactive presentations. Help secure customer buy-in by more effectively communicating your designs with an immersive interactive environment and storytelling features.

Autodesk® 3ds Max®
Cinematic animation and near-photorealism – Autodesk 3ds Max software provides architects, engineers, and visualization specialists with sophisticated 3D visualization tools that extend the BIM workflow with “push-button” cinematic-quality rendering and 3D animation. In 3ds Max 2016, you get:
- Tighter integration with Revit
- Up to 10x faster import
- Cleaner geometry
- Improved instancing
- Additional BIM data
- Multiple cameras
